
很多同学需要在首页及列表页显示当前文章的tag标签并且带链接,小编的网站首页就加了tag表,并且用了伪静态显示,下面小编就给大家分析一下!
1、先找到include/helpers/archive.helper.php,搜一下GetTags,直接替换掉
if ( ! function_exists('GetTags'))
{
function GetTags($aid)
{
global $dsql;
$tags = '';
$query = "SELECT tag FROM `de_kd_taglist` WHERE aid='$aid' ";
$dsql->Execute('tag',$query);
while($row = $dsql->GetArray('tag,tid'))
{
$tags .= "<a href='自己的链接".urlencode($row['tag'])."'>".$row['tag']."</a>";
}
return $tags;
}
}
上面已经布局好了,用的是tags.php的,如果需要用伪静态来做的话,需要用把tid加进去,根据tag标签的id形成链接。
2、调用到页面中
[field:id function=GetTags(@me)/]
上面是“dedecms在列表或首页显示tag标签带链接”的全面内容,想了解更多关于 织梦cms 内容,请继续关注web建站教程。
当前网址:https://m.ipkd.cn/webs_1418.html
声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!

利用css3做一个动态loading效果
javascript中append()方法使用实例介绍
MeteoRA:南京大学开发的高效多任务嵌入框架,助力大语言模型性能飞跃
盘点互联网经典黑话50句(附2024年阿里黑话大全)
一个免费的企业名称生成AI工具——Namelix